Output ede586c4d066054531ad632f95a46913c4319772ea59c13d3144892286bdedaa:0

value
270300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 008a12ae2c688640fcb78c60dcb63ade19d363e2 OP_EQUAL
address
31jsL2DwuKMG1aXPqVKgFJum227kLo5jgd
transaction
ede586c4d066054531ad632f95a46913c4319772ea59c13d3144892286bdedaa
spent
true